Rajkumar Pandian
Rajkumar Pandian (RK Pandian) is an Indian Police Service officer. He came to attention over claims in the death of Sohrabuddin Sheikh. From 2016 he was Inspector-general of police in Junagadh, even while the Sohrabuddin case was in courts.[1] In 2018 the Bombay High Court upheld his discharge from this case.[2]
Sohrabuddin case
[edit | edit source]In 2007 Rajnish Rai arrested Pandian along with D G Vanzara and Dinesh M N related to the death of Sohrabuddin Sheikh.[3] In March 2014 Pandian got bail after having been in prison for seven years since his 2007 arrest.[4]
In April 2013 The Hindu reported that Pandian was found to be at his home during the time when he was supposed to be incarcerated.[5] The explanation seemed to be that Pandian was getting undisclosed and favored treatment to leave the jail.[5]
After 2014
[edit | edit source]In 2016 Pandian held a position at the Gujarat Industrial Development Corporation.[1] Following that position, he took a post as Inspector-general of police in Junagadh.[1] There was consideration in 2017 that he might take a post in the Ahmedabad crime Branch.[6]
In February 2018 Pandian claimed that the Central Bureau of Investigation had framed him in the Sohrabuddin case.[7][8] In 2018 the Bombay High Court upheld Pandian's discharge from the Sohrabuddin case.[2]
In 2019 Pandian arrested cybercriminals who had stolen money from his wife.[9]
In 2019 Pandian expressed interest in reviewing criminal complaints about land disputes.[10]
